JavaScript中的MVVM模式是什么,如何使用MVVM模式?

我很想了解一下JavaScript中的MVVM模式,据我所知MVVM是一种现代的前端设计模式,主要用于将应用程序的业务逻辑和用户界面数据进行分离。想要在JavaScript中使用MVVM模式,我们需要使用一些MVVM库,比如AngularJS、Vue.js、React等等。这些库允许我们使用MVVM来构建可重用的组件,使用数据绑定来简化DOM操作以及实现数据和UI界面的同步更新。那么,如果您是初学者,您是否可以给我提供一些更具体的教程和代码示例来了解MVVM模式的实现?

提问时间:2023-06-29 13:14:23 编辑时间:2023-06-29 13:14:25 提问者: City_Lights
  • Enchanted_Garden
    2

    MVVM模式是一种前端设计模式,指的是Model-View-ViewModel,其中Model表示业务逻辑和数据模型,View表示用户界面,而ViewModel则作为连接业务逻辑数据和用户界面的桥梁,实现了对数据的双向绑定。在JavaScript中使用MVVM模式,可以选择使用一些MVVM库,如AngularJS、Vue.js、React等。

    使用MVVM模式可以将应用程序的业务逻辑和用户界面数据进行分离,有效提高代码的可重用性和性能。MVVM库提供了一些特有的指令和语法,使得我们能更便捷地实现双向绑定以及组件化开发。

    如果你想深入了解MVVM模式的实现,可以查看一些相关的教程和代码示例。例如,Vue.js官网上提供了详细的教程和文档,AngularJS也有许多教程和代码示例供参考。在学习MVVM模式时,建议先了解其基本概念和原理,再逐步阅读相关文档和实践代码案例。

    回答时间:2023-06-29 13:14:28